You're a grandmother, … WebOur Town begins with birth and death - Dr. Gibbs delivers twins even as the Stage Manager tells us of the deaths to come of Dr. and Mrs. Gibbs. And so it ends, with Emily's death in giving birth to her child. So the cycle continues - and in other ways as well. Act Three is similar to those that precede it, though the subject matter is much darker. cheryl ogle https://ambiasmarthome.com

Video Examples. WebIronically, according to Emily’s experience during her flashback, the living despair about the end of life, but do not make much effort to cherish life while they still have it. Emily, however, is only able to realize how precious her life is after she has died.

WebSummary. The play opens with a view of an empty, curtainless, half-lighted stage. The Stage Manager enters and arranges minimal scenery—a table and three chairs—to represent two houses, one on each side of the stage. The houselights dim as the Stage Manager moves about the stage.
